About the Company - Who are we?At AutoVRse, we build the finest, customized Virtual & Augmented Reality (VR/AR) applications, helping enterprises harness the power of immersive technologies across several key functions. Combining our photo-realistic visualizations with interactive virtual environments, we have partnered with firms like Shell, Bosch, Aditya Birla Group, Godrej, and Go-Jek to deploy VR experiences in India, Singapore, Australia, Switzerland, Germany and USA. Our experiences are used in design reviews, as sales tools, for experiential marketing and for virtual training.Learn more about us here:About AutoVRseAbout GRO VRGRO VR is building the next generation of multiplayer VR experiences on Meta Quest.
